The Shifting Sands of the Battlefield
The front lines in Ukraine are constantly evolving, and recent news shows a complex picture. We're seeing intense fighting in several key areas, with both sides making tactical gains and facing significant challenges. Ukrainian forces have been showcasing remarkable resilience and adaptability, employing innovative strategies to counter the Russian advance. Their determination to defend their homeland is palpable, and international observers are noting their effectiveness, especially in utilizing Western-supplied weaponry. On the other hand, Russian troops continue their efforts to secure and expand their control over occupied territories. The strategic importance of cities like Bakhmut and Avdiivka has led to some of the most brutal and protracted battles of the war. These clashes are not just about territorial gains; they represent crucial strategic objectives for both Moscow and Kyiv. The human cost of this intense fighting is, of course, immense, with significant casualties reported on both sides, underscoring the tragic reality of this conflict. Military analysts are closely watching the supply lines, ammunition availability, and troop morale for both armies, as these factors will undoubtedly play a pivotal role in shaping the immediate future of the conflict on the ground. The weather also often plays a role, with muddy seasons making large-scale offenses more difficult and favoring defensive positions. We're also seeing an increase in drone warfare, with both sides deploying a variety of unmanned aerial vehicles for reconnaissance, targeting, and even direct attacks, adding a new dimension to the battlefield dynamics. Economic Repercussions: Global and Local
The economic fallout from the Ukraine war is far-reaching, impacting global markets and individual livelihoods. Inflation has been exacerbated worldwide, driven by supply chain disruptions and rising energy and food prices. Global trade routes have been significantly affected, leading to increased shipping costs and delays. For Russia, the impact of extensive international sanctions has been considerable, affecting its currency, financial institutions, and access to international markets, although its economy has shown some resilience due to high energy prices initially. Ukraine's economy has been devastated, with infrastructure damage, reduced production, and massive displacement of its workforce creating immense challenges for recovery and rebuilding. The energy sector has been particularly volatile, with countries scrambling to secure stable and affordable energy supplies, leading to a push for renewable energy and diversification. The food security of many nations, especially those heavily reliant on grain imports from Ukraine and Russia, has been put at risk, leading to humanitarian concerns and price hikes. Investment in the region has plummeted, and the long-term economic outlook for both countries, and indeed for Eastern Europe, remains uncertain. The cost of rebuilding Ukraine alone is estimated to be in the hundreds of billions of dollars, posing a significant challenge for international funding and domestic resources.
